WCIA Historical Walking Tour: Nadine Waters

Join us during Wyoming’s Juneteenth Celebration for our inaugural historical walking touring starring Wyoming classical soprano Nadine Waters (1892-1985). Nadine sang in the great concert halls of Europe, studied in Boston, and fought racial discrimination every step of the way. Learn about her father, Martin Van Roberts, her mother and sisters, and the Maple Street church they loved. This is a story of passion, persistence, grit and community, unique to Wyoming.
